End Markets for Finished Compost

Just as with traditional recyclables, closing the loop is essential for successful organics management. The loop is closed with the productive use of finished compost. This webinar, jointly hosted by NERC and NEWMOA, discussed end market applications and examples from organizations that compost food and other organics. Purchasing Standards for Low Carbon Concrete

This webinar was co-organized and sponsored by NEWMOA, NERC, and the West Coast Climate and Materials Management Forum (WCMMF). Concrete is a critical building material. However, the cement binder used in concrete is responsible for around eight per cent of humanmade CO2 emissions. This webinar explored low carbon concrete options and the growing number of […]

Avoiding Contamination in Food Waste Feedstock for Composting

The usefulness and value of finished compost depends on a feedstock that is free of contaminants, such as plastic and non-degradable service ware and bags. Unfortunately, it is all too common to find these materials in food waste destined for composting.
